Long Beach expands monkeypox vaccine eligibility again

Summary by Ground News
Long Beach has expanded eligibility multiple times in recent months as it works to stop the spread of monkeypox. The move aligns the city with Los Angeles County. Monkeypox is in the smallpox family but is far less deadly. There were 112 confirmed and probable monkeypox cases in Long Beach, the health department said.
